MnDOT meeting in Cromwell

 

March 31, 2023



The Minnesota Department of Transportation is hosting a hybrid public meeting on Wednesday, April 5, to discuss the Minnesota Highway 73 corridor study from Kettle River to Cromwell. Doors open at 5 p.m. in the Cromwell Pavilion with a formal presentation at 5:15 p.m.

To attend virtually at 5:15 p.m., find the link at mndot.gov/d1/projects/hwy-73-corridor-study or call in at 855-282-6330. Meeting access code: 2491 961 9499. A recording of the meeting will be posted to the project website.

The corridor is being studied to understand existing and future transportation needs and inform future projects. Results of the $520,000 study will help MnDOT and local agencies plan improvement projects to address existing issues and plan for the future of the corridor.
